James:4




nsb@James:4:1 @ What causes wars and fighting among you? Is the cause of fighting your sensual lusts for pleasure that battle within you?

nsb@James:4:2 @ You lust, and do not have. You murder and covet and cannot obtain! You fight and war. You do not have because you do not ask.

nsb@James:4:3 @ You ask and do not receive because you ask wrongly that you may spend it on your pleasures.

nsb@James:4:4 @ Adulteresses, do you not know that friendship with the world is enmity toward God? Whoever would be a friend of the world makes himself an enemy of God.

nsb@James:4:5 @ Or do you think the scripture speaks to no purpose? Does the attitude of the heart that he induced to live in us cause us to envy?

nsb@James:4:6 @ But he gives more grace. The scripture said, "God resists the proud, but gives grace to the humble."

nsb@James:4:7 @ Be subject to God! Resist the Devil and he will flee from you.

nsb@James:4:8 @ Draw close to God, and he will draw close to you. Cleanse your hands, you sinners; and purify your hearts, you double-minded.

nsb@James:4:9 @ Be afflicted, and mourn, and weep: let your laughter be turned to mourning, and your joy to heaviness.

nsb@James:4:10 @ Humble yourselves in the presence of God, and he will exalt you.

nsb@James:4:11 @ Brothers, do not speak against each other. He who speaks against a brother, or judges his brother, speaks against the law, and judges the law. If you judge the law, you are not a doer of the law, but a judge.

nsb@James:4:12 @ Only one is the lawgiver and judge, even he who is able to save and to destroy. Who are you that you judge your neighbor?

nsb@James:4:13 @ Come now, you that say, "Today or tomorrow we will go to this city, and spend a year there, and trade, and make profit."

nsb@James:4:14 @ You do not know what will happen tomorrow. What is your life? For you are a vapor that appears for a little while and then vanishes away.

nsb@James:4:15 @ You should say, "If God wills, we should both live, and do this or that."

nsb@James:4:16 @ You glory in your conceit. Such glory is evil.

nsb@James:4:17 @ He that knows to do good, and does not do it, to him it is sin.
